Dublin City is split up into different postal areas. O'Connell Street, in the heart of the city, starts with Dublin 1. Across the O'Connell Bridge at the River Liffey is Dublin 2 and is where Temple Bar, Grafton Street and Trinity College is located. If you are spending a weekend in Dublin it is mostly likely you'll be staying in these two areas.
From Dublin Airport By Bus
There are a number of bus services that run from Dublin Airport directly into the city centre. The Aircoach is one example of the airport shuttles buses. See out Airport Bus guide if needing more information.
The airport bus will drop off at the main bus which is located in Dublin 1. It is a 5 minutes walk from O'Connell Street. If you do not fancy walking there is a Taxi Rank available or the Luas line located out the back of the building. A Taxi into Dublin 2 can cost from 10 Euro - 17 Euro, depending on traffic. The Red Luas line runs across North Dublin into the West and and is one stop from O'Connell Street. A fare on the Luas depends on your destination but if you stop is at O'Connell Street then it costs 1.70 Euro for a single fare. Dublin 2 is only a short walking distance from O'Connell Street
Dublin Airport By Taxi
There is a Taxi rank located outside the arrivals gate. A typical journey into the city centre can take anywhere from 20 minutes - 45 depending on the traffic. If traveling by Taxi through rush hour traffic always allow up to 2hrs extra travel time to keep it safe.

From Sea Port To City Centre
If you are coming into Dublin from the Ferry you'll be located on the edge of Dublin 1 at the port. This is a 5 or 10 minute walk from O'Connell Street or Busaras (central Bus stop). It is also in walking distance to Temple Bar but if you are hauling luggage then a hopping into a Taxi would be a better idea.
